Understanding the Format and Its Role in Modern Craft Workflows
Multi layer paper cut dog 3d svg decor represents a specific intersection of vector design, layered papercraft, and three-dimensional display. At its core, it is a digital file—typically an SVG (Scalable Vector Graphic)—that has been segmented into multiple layers, each intended to be cut from a separate sheet of paper, cardstock, or similar material. When assembled in sequence, these layers produce a dimensional, shadow-box-style depiction of a dog. The result is a tactile, sculptural piece that can be framed, displayed on a shelf, or incorporated into a larger mixed-media project.
Understanding this format is important for anyone who works with cutting machines, digital design tools, or physical craft production. It is not a single-use decorative item but a modular asset that can be resized, recolored, re-layered, and repurposed. This flexibility makes it valuable for small business owners producing inventory, educators planning classroom projects, hobbyists exploring paper sculpture, and content creators looking for reproducible design elements.

Integration with Tools, Platforms, and Other Resources
Multi layer paper cut dog 3d svg decor does not exist in isolation. It interacts with several categories of tools and resources:
- Design software: Programs like Adobe Illustrator, Inkscape, Affinity Designer, or Cricut Design Space are used to open, inspect, and sometimes modify the SVG. You may need to ungroup layers, adjust dimensions, or recolor elements to fit your material palette.
- Cutting machines: Devices from Cricut, Silhouette, Brother, or other manufacturers read the SVG and translate it into cut paths. Machine calibration, blade sharpness, and material thickness all affect the final cut quality.
- Materials: Cardstock in various weights and colors, foam adhesive squares or tapes for creating depth, mounting boards, and frames. The material selection directly impacts the dimensional effect and durability.
- Assembly tools: A weeding tool (or craft knife) for removing small cut pieces, tweezers for placement, a bone folder for creasing, and a cutting mat for protecting your work surface.
- Online marketplaces and design communities: Platforms like Etsy, Creative Market, Design Bundles, and FreeSVG offer these files. Reviews, previews, and seller descriptions help you evaluate file quality before purchase.
- Other craft assets: This SVG can be combined with other layered files (e.g., a background scene, a frame, or a personalized nameplate) to create a larger composition.
The key integration point is the software-to-machine pipeline. If the SVG is poorly grouped, has stray paths, or uses non-standard color layers, it can cause confusion during cutting or assembly. Verifying file integrity early prevents wasted material and frustration later.
Evaluating the File Before Cutting
Before you commit paper to the cutting mat, open the SVG in your design software. Check the number of layers. A well-structured multi-layer dog SVG will have each layer clearly separated, often with color-coded fills or labeled layers. Look for these indicators:
- Each layer is a distinct group or compound path.
- There are no overlapping or duplicate paths that could cause double-cutting.
- All layers fit within the intended material size (e.g., 12×12 inch or A4).
- Details such as eyes, whiskers, or small fur textures are large enough to cut and handle without tearing.
If the file includes a preview image or assembly guide, study it to understand the intended layer order. Some sellers provide a PDF instruction sheet. Save this reference—it will save time during assembly.
Choosing Materials for Depth and Contrast
The visual impact of a multi-layer paper cut piece depends heavily on material choice. For a dog design, consider these options:
- Background layer: Use a heavier cardstock (80–100 lb) in a neutral or contrasting color. This provides structural support.
- Intermediate layers: Standard 65–80 lb cardstock works well. Use foam tape between layers to create physical depth. The thickness of the foam (1–3 mm) determines how much shadow is cast.
- Top detail layers: Thinner paper (60–65 lb) can work for fine details, but it is harder to handle. Test a small piece first.
- Color palette: Choose shades that have clear contrast. Light body with dark ears and eyes creates a readable silhouette. Avoid colors that are too similar between adjacent layers, as they will blend together and reduce the dimensional effect.
If you are producing multiple units for sale, standardize your material selection. Consistency in paper weight, color, and foam thickness ensures that each assembled piece looks uniform and professional.
Cut Order and Machine Settings
Most cutting machines allow you to cut layers in any order, but there is a practical sequence. Cut the largest layers first (background, then body, then smaller details). This way, if a layer fails, you have not wasted the smaller, more intricate pieces. Adjust your machine settings based on material: increase pressure for thicker cardstock, reduce speed for detailed cuts, and use a fresh blade to avoid frayed edges on small features.
If your machine uses a mat, ensure the material is firmly adhered. Curling or lifting material during cutting can shift alignment, especially for multi-layer projects that require precise registration. Some users prefer to cut all layers from the same batch of cardstock to minimize color variation.
Assembly as a Process Step
Assembly is not just gluing pieces together. It is a sequential process that benefits from planning:
- Sort layers in the order they will be stacked. Use the SVG preview or assembly guide as a reference.
- Dry-fit the layers without adhesive to confirm alignment. This is especially important for the first time you assemble a particular SVG.
- Apply adhesive strategically. For layers with small or thin elements, use a fine-tip glue applicator or small pieces of foam tape. Avoid glue pooling near edges, as it can seep out and discolor the paper.
- Build from back to front. Attach the background layer first, then add each subsequent layer with foam tape or adhesive spacers. Use tweezers for precise placement of small elements like eyes or nose.
- Press firmly for each layer to ensure good adhesion, but avoid pressing so hard that you flatten the foam tape, which reduces depth.
- Allow the assembled piece to dry under light weight (a book or a flat board) to prevent warping, especially if you used liquid adhesive.
If you are producing these decor pieces in bulk, consider creating an assembly station with pre-cut foam squares, labeled layer trays, and a consistent adhesive process. This reduces handling time and errors.
Quality Control and Long-Term Use
After assembly, inspect the piece from multiple angles. Look for:
- Misaligned layers that cause gaps or overlapping edges.
- Adhesive visible from the side or front.
- Loose small pieces that may detach over time.
- Warping due to uneven adhesive application or moisture.
For long-term durability, consider sealing the assembled piece with a clear matte spray to protect against dust and light fading. If the piece will be shipped, package it so that layers cannot shift. Bubble wrap and a rigid envelope or box are recommended.
Store unused SVG files in a well-organized folder structure. Name files clearly (e.g., “Dog_GoldenRetriever_12x12_5Layer.svg”) and include a notes file with material recommendations and assembly tips from your experience. This becomes a reusable resource for future projects.

Observations on Efficiency and Consistency
One of the most overlooked aspects of working with multi-layer SVGs is the time saved by starting with a well-structured file. If you have ever tried to manually separate merged layers or reconstruct missing cut paths, you know how quickly that erodes productivity. A clean SVG is an efficiency multiplier. It allows you to focus on creative decisions—color, scale, framing—rather than file repair.
Consistency comes from documentation. After you assemble a multi-layer dog decor piece, take notes. Which foam tape thickness worked best? Did the eyes align perfectly or did they need manual trimming? How long did assembly take? These notes become your quality control reference. When you produce the same design again, you can replicate the successful process without guesswork.
Another observation: the depth effect is more noticeable when layers have distinct shapes and do not simply shrink uniformly. A good multi-layer SVG will have each layer contribute unique cutouts—for example, the head layer might have eye holes, while the ear layer overlaps the head at a slight offset. This creates shadows and visual interest. If you evaluate an SVG and the layers are just scaled-down copies of the same silhouette, the final piece will look flat. Look for files where each layer adds new geometry.

Final Practical Considerations
Before purchasing or downloading any multi layer paper cut dog 3d svg decor file, check the license terms if you intend to sell the finished products. Some files come with commercial use rights, others are limited to personal use. Respecting these terms protects you legally and supports the designers who create these assets.
Also verify that the SVG uses standard cutting machine formats. While SVG is a universal vector format, some files are optimized for specific machines and may include proprietary elements. If you use a Cricut, ensure the file is compatible with Cricut Design Space. If you use a Silhouette, check that the file opens in Silhouette Studio without errors. A quick test cut on scrap paper can save you from wasting good cardstock.
Finally, keep your cutting machine firmware and software updated. Machine updates sometimes change how SVG files are interpreted, and staying current reduces compatibility issues. If you rely on a specific SVG for production, test it after any major software update before running a batch of cuts.
